Transaction db62a186d755f16ef0124d1c5c42f4e235732a832bb08e12583548dd82dd71a0
1 Input
1 Output
-
db62a186d755f16ef0124d1c5c42f4e235732a832bb08e12583548dd82dd71a0:0
- value
- 104698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82eade49e496a6957d84ba2860fbc9f1b345633a OP_EQUAL
- address
- 3DdF8RDW4L1YAtt7Dcg1e1tXTXhWpio5QF